网页格式怎么转换成Excel?如何快速实现?
作者:佚名|分类:EXCEL|浏览:66|发布时间:2025-04-03 19:32:23
网页格式怎么转换成Excel?如何快速实现?
随着互联网的普及,网页已经成为我们获取信息、处理数据的重要途径。然而,网页上的数据格式通常与Excel表格格式不同,这就给我们的数据处理带来了不便。那么,如何将网页格式转换成Excel表格呢?本文将为您详细介绍几种快速实现网页格式转换成Excel的方法。
一、使用在线转换工具
1. 选择在线转换工具
目前,市面上有很多在线转换工具可以帮助我们将网页格式转换成Excel表格。以下是一些常用的在线转换工具:
(1)Smallpdf:提供网页转Excel、PDF转Excel等功能。
(2)Convertio:支持多种文件格式转换,包括网页转Excel。
(3)Online-Convert:提供网页转Excel、PDF转Excel等功能。
2. 操作步骤
以Smallpdf为例,以下是使用在线转换工具将网页格式转换成Excel的步骤:
(1)打开Smallpdf官网,点击“网页转Excel”功能。
(2)在弹出的页面中,输入网页链接或上传网页文件。
(3)选择输出格式为Excel。
(4)点击“转换”按钮,等待转换完成。
(5)下载转换后的Excel文件。
二、使用浏览器插件
1. 选择浏览器插件
目前,市面上也有一些浏览器插件可以帮助我们将网页格式转换成Excel表格。以下是一些常用的浏览器插件:
(1)Save as Excel:可以将网页内容直接保存为Excel格式。
(2)Save Page As:可以将网页内容保存为多种格式,包括Excel。
3. 操作步骤
以Save as Excel插件为例,以下是使用浏览器插件将网页格式转换成Excel的步骤:
(1)在浏览器中安装Save as Excel插件。
(2)打开需要转换的网页。
(3)点击插件图标,选择“保存为Excel”。
(4)选择保存路径和文件名,点击“保存”。
三、使用Python脚本
1. 安装Python和库
首先,需要在电脑上安装Python和以下库:BeautifulSoup、pandas、openpyxl。
2. 编写Python脚本
以下是一个简单的Python脚本示例,用于将网页格式转换成Excel表格:
```python
from bs4 import BeautifulSoup
import pandas as pd
网页链接
url = 'http://example.com'
请求网页内容
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
提取表格数据
table = soup.find('table')
rows = table.find_all('tr')
data = []
for row in rows:
cols = row.find_all('td')
cols = [col.text.strip() for col in cols]
data.append(cols)
创建DataFrame
df = pd.DataFrame(data)
保存为Excel
df.to_excel('output.xlsx', index=False)
```
3. 运行Python脚本
将上述脚本保存为.py文件,在命令行中运行该脚本,即可将网页格式转换成Excel表格。
四、相关问答
1. 问题:在线转换工具是否需要付费?
回答:大多数在线转换工具提供免费的基础功能,但部分高级功能可能需要付费。
2. 问题:如何确保转换后的Excel表格格式正确?
回答:在转换过程中,可以手动调整表格格式,如列宽、字体等。
3. 问题:Python脚本是否需要安装额外的库?
回答:是的,Python脚本需要安装BeautifulSoup、pandas、openpyxl等库。
4. 问题:如何处理网页中的JavaScript渲染内容?
回答:可以使用Selenium等工具模拟浏览器行为,获取JavaScript渲染的内容。
总结
将网页格式转换成Excel表格的方法有很多,您可以根据自己的需求选择合适的方法。希望本文能帮助您快速实现网页格式转换成Excel。